Based on recent form and performance, Somerset head into their June 1 clash against Essex at the County Ground in Chelmsford as the clear favorites. Essex are coming off a bruising 106-run loss to Hampshire, a match in which their bowling unit was dismantled—conceding 230 runs in 20 overs—with key bowlers like Amir and Cook proving expensive and ineffective.
Their batting was equally brittle, collapsing to 124 all out in 16.2 overs, exposing the lack of depth and resilience in their middle order. In contrast, Somerset showcased both discipline and flair in a confident 5-wicket victory over a strong Surrey side. Their bowlers, led by Matt Henry (3/21) and Riley Meredith (3/26), restricted Surrey to 146, and the batting unit chased it down clinically with Tom Abell anchoring the innings and Smeed, Banton, and Green providing fluent cameos.
Somerset’s pace attack has bite, and their batting lineup is dynamic yet balanced. Essex do have explosive players—Michael-Kyle Pepper was impressive with 51 in the last match—but their overreliance on individual sparks rather than a cohesive team performance is proving costly. While Chelmsford’s shorter boundaries might assist Essex’s aggressive intent, Somerset’s more in-form and tactically astute side is better positioned to exploit pressure situations.
Unless Essex produce something special—particularly with the ball—Somerset should extend their winning run.
